Sydney’s rapid suburban expansion into Western Sydney requires extensive rainwater harvesting, agricultural storage, and chemical processing tanks. Our Rock & Roll machines produce heavy-duty cylindrical tanks up to 30,000 Liters with uniform wall thickness and stress-free structural integrity, fully meeting AS/NZS 4766 standards.
The coastal and harbor marine sectors demand rotomolded pontoons, navigation buoys, marina floats, and kayak hulls resistant to extreme salt corrosion and UV degradation. Our Swing Oven and Shuttle machines handle large-scale CNC cast-aluminum moulds designed for seamless, leak-proof marine assemblies.
Serving regional NSW mining and interstate freight hubs, rotomolded heavy-duty pallets, dangerous goods spill bunds, and insulated transport boxes demand extreme impact resistance. Our high-torque carousel machines ensure consistent plasticization of heavy linear low-density polyethylene (LLDPE) and XLPE materials.
Sydney municipal councils prioritize public safety and design aesthetics. Our precision aluminum tooling enables custom OEM creation of vibrant, ergonomic playground slides, outdoor furniture, and large public waste containers with zero sharp weld seams.
Why Sydney enterprise buyers are replacing traditional steel and fiberglass fabrication with StarWay Roto automated lines.
| Performance Metrics | StarWay OEM Rotomolding Line | Traditional Steel Fabrication | Fiberglass (FRP) Moulding |
|---|---|---|---|
| Structural Integrity | Seamless 1-Piece Hollow Construction | Welded Seams (Prone to Stress Cracks) | Layered Resin (Delamination Risk) |
| Corrosion & Salt Resistance | 100% Rust-Proof Chemical PE | Requires Constant Recoating | Moderate Corrosion Resistance |
| UV Protection Rating | UV15+ to UV20+ Australian Grade | Paint Degrades Under Heat | Gelcoat Chalking Over Time |
| Tooling & Mould Capital Cost | Low to Medium (Cast/CNC Aluminum) | High Stamping Die Costs | Medium Hand-Layup Tool Costs |
| Energy Consumption per Ton | Optimized Recirculating Thermal Oven | High Energy Arc Welding Lines | Manual Resin Curing (Labor Heavy) |
